Your Digga Planetary drive unit is a high performance attachment that is designed for drilling, screw anchoring
(Pier) installation, core barreling and other extreme applications where it is seeing high levels of torque. To avoid
premature wear and failure, and to full your terms of warranty please read this statement.
All Digga Planetary drive units must have a rst oil change within the rst 30 hours (extreme use) or 50
hours (moderate use) or 3 months of use, which ever comes rst to ensure the bed in of the drive unit.
For more detailed information please read the maintenance section of this manual.
If the rst oil change is not performed within this period, excessive wear within the gearbox will occur
that will cause premature failure and all Warranty will be voided.
Oil must then be changed thereafter every 300 hours (extreme use) or 500 hours (moderate use) and
a full service every 12 months must be performed by an authorised service agent to ensure Warranty
requirements are met.
In the event of a failure under the warranty period:
Contact Digga immediately, do not disassemble your drive without rst obtaining written permission and
instructions from Digga.
Proof of service must be provided in hard copy form of both operational and service history records
(including serial number of gearbox and hydraulic motor). Service must be performed by an authorised
Digga service agent.
